Rosa Maria de los Heros is an artist who bridges the technological with the mystical, exploring how light transforms materials in dialogue with the unseen. She has exhibited internationally with solo presentations in Barcelona and Panamá as well as group shows in venues such as Musée de Louvre (Paris, France), Banco Continental (Lima, Perú), and the Angel Orensanz Foundation (New York, NY). Her work has been featured by Prada Journal. She received a BFA from the Studio Art Program at NYU and an MFA from Bard College.
